#d3cf98 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d3cf98 is composed of 82.7% red, 81.2%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.9% magenta, 28%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 55.9 degrees, a saturation of 40.1% and a lightness of 71.2%. #d3cf98 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a79f31.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#d3cf98 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d3cf98 has RGB values of R:211, G:207,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.02, Y:0.28,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13881240.
